

ROOKS, Ann Ford, 75, of Richmond, passed away Monday, March 28, 2016, at 7:30 in the evening, to join her Heavenly Father. She was preceded in death by her husband, Sam L. Rooks Sr.; and her mother, Annie Ford. She is survived by her father, George Ford Sr.; her son, Sam L. Rooks Jr. (Robin); her daughters, Theresa Rooks and Caralee Rooks Belcher (Larry); granddaughters, Kelsey Rooks McLain (Kevin) and Jocelyn Rooks Lindsay (Matthew); and grandson, Lawrence Belcher; siblings, Dot Langley (E.L.), Barbara Clanton (Phil), George Ford Jr. (Susan), Tommy Ford (Donna), David Ford; 22 nieces and nephews and a devoted extended family. She was a devout Christian, a faithful church member of Skipwith Baptist Church and an active member of the Richmond Emmaus Community. Ann loved spending time at the beach with her family, singing in choir, reading, gardening and spending time with her loved ones. She was a kind and loving mother, grandmother, sister, friend and neighbor, and was always willing to lend a helping hand to those in need. Her example is a legacy her family will cherish and she will be missed by all whose lives she touched. Visitation will be Thursday, March 31, from 4 to 7 p.m., at Woody Funeral Home-Parham Chapel, 1771 N. Parham Rd., Richmond, Va. 23229. Her memorial service will be 2 p.m. Friday, April 1, at Skipwith Baptist Church, 1900 Skipwith Rd., Richmond, Va. 23229. Interment will follow at Greenwood Memorial Gardens. A reception will follow at Skipwith Baptist Church. In lieu of flowers, contributions can be made to Skipwith Baptist Church in Ann's memory.
